Marvel Super Heroes: War of the Gems, an unrelated action game, was released for the SNES in 1996. The game involves utilizing each of the Marvel superheroes through each of their levels to collect one of the Gems needed to complete the game. The SNES features Iron Man, Captain America, Hulk, Wolverine, and Spider-Man.

The Amazing Spider-Man 2 is a 2014 action-adventure video game [1] [2] based on the Marvel Comics character Spider-Man and the 2014 film of the same name.Developed by Beenox, it is the sequel to 2012's The Amazing Spider-Man, itself based on the 2012 film of the same name. and takes place within the same continuity, different from that of the films.
